From
Set amidst the idyllic Eola-Amity Hills AVA in Oregon, the Roserock Vineyard tells a story of transcontinental passion. It’s the welcoming embrace of cooling Pacific breezes and sun-kissed days, where the legacy of Burgundy meets Oregon’s pioneering spirit. It’s more than a vineyard; it’s a bridge across worlds.
Crafted by the Joseph Drouhin family, this wine is a testimony to tradition and innovation, seamlessly blending the best of two worlds into a single, harmonious bottle. The estate proudly adheres to LIVE-certified sustainable viticulture, crafting wines with respect for both grape and ground, ensuring the legacy of flavor continues to enrich future generations.
